What the petition asks
Conduct a review of policy at Ofcom. We think that political news reporting on all channels has become unrepresentative of the public vote at the last general election and that political reporting using the ‘due weight’ policy is allowing extreme growth in far right coverage.
We believe the coverage being received by far right political parties is emboldening far right groups in the UK and this has started to cause division, unrest and violence in communities.
There are concerns that news outlets are increasingly using dramatic headlines that lean towards the far right in order to gain viewers and readers. It has become too easy for far right groups to manufacture situations, such as the migrant hotel protests, in order to give them even more due weight, causing a feedback loop of far right rhetoric.
